    You can find the Tyrannosaur in the desert or you can find him at a more common place.

    You can find him in the Forest south of Gaia. From where you park the air ship walk 8 steps east and about 3 steps south. You should find him there pretty soon.

    Yes the last boss does count towards your monster list, he only shows up when you complete the game and save the completed game and then start the game again, then he shows up in the list.
